| Lloyd Webber plans US reality show |
Stage - London, London, UK
- Andrew Lloyd Webber has signed with Hollywood’s William Morris Agency in an attempt to secure a television deal for an American reality show, similar to the BBC’s Any Dream Will Do.
Lloyd Webber is expected to travel to Hollywood later this year to meet television executives and is hoping to convince them not to be put off by the recent failure of NBC’s You’re the One that I Want, which searched for talent to star in a new production of Grease.

| Andrew Lloyd Webber and Elton John Will Be Among "Concert for Diana" Performers |
Playbill.com - New York, NY, USA
- Broadway composers Andrew Lloyd Webber and Elton John are among the performers scheduled for the July 1 "Concert for Diana" in London's new Wembley Stadium.
Prince William and Prince Harry commemorate what would have been their mother's 46th birthday 10 years after her tragic death "with an event to celebrate her life."
